A History of the Kentucky National Guard in Times of War and Peace

Introduction

This is a history of the Kentucky National Guard, a military institution whose existence antedates the United States itself. Although the name "National Guard" was not applied to a State Militia until 1824, the fundamental concept of a state or local Military organization has existed since 1636, when the Colony of Massachusetts formed a regiment of "Trained Bands."

Throughout her history, Kentucky has cherished the tradition of rendering military duty with zeal when called upon. Kentucky's history teems with incidents of self-sacrifice unsurpassed in daring and achievement. Kentuckians have answered the call to arms in all wars of our country.
